2 Landmark Embedding Scheme for Shortest Distance Query Landmark Embedding Graph: G(V, E, W ) Landmarks: S = {l 1,, l k } V Embedding: l S, v V, compute δ(l, v) Querying: q = (a, b), estimate Widely used in Road networks [11, 4]; δ(a, b) = min l i S {δ(l i, a) + δ(l i, b)} Social networks and web graphs [8, 7, 10, 2]; Internet graphs[1, 5];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

8 Other Shortest Distance Computing Approaches Spatial Networks Euclidean distance as a lower bound to prune the search space (Papadias et al [6]) Path-distance oracle of size O(n max(s d, 1 ϵ d )), and answer a query with ϵ-approximation in O(log n) time (Sankaranarayanan et al [9]) Drawback: coordinate dependent Exact distance indexing on non-spatial Networks Tree-width decomposition based [13] Drawback: not scalable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

9 Global Landmark Embedding Drawbacks Large error for nearby query nodes δ ( l, a) δ ( l, b) δ ( a, b) ~ δ ( a, b) = δ ( l, a) + δ ( l, b) >> δ ( a, b) Improving accuracy by increasing S draws large overhead Global Landmark Embedding Complexity: Query time: O( S ) Index time: O( S V log( V )) Index size: O( S V )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

12 Query-Dependent Local Landmarks Example Landmark set S = {l 1, l 2, l 3 } For a query (a, b), P(a, b) = (a, e, f, g, b) l 1 l 2 P(l 1, a) = (l 1, c, e, a), P(l 1, b) = (l 1, c, d, g, b) Based on landmark l 1, δ(a, b) = δ(l 1, a) + δ(l 1, b) a c d e f g h l 3 b But based on node c, δ L (a, b) = δ(c, a) + δ(c, b) is more accurate because δ(a, b) = δ L (a, b) + 2δ(l 1, c)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

15 Query-Dependent Local Landmarks Definition (Query-Dependent Local Landmark Function) Given a global landmark set S a query (a, b), L ab (S) : V k V A more accurate distance estimation, r a,b L ab (S) δ L (a, b) = δ(r a,b, a) + δ(r a,b, b) Requirements for a local landmark function: Efficiently retrieve L ab (S); Efficiently compute δ(l ab (S), a), δ(l ab (S), b); Compact index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

16 SPT Based Local Landmark Function Definition (SPT Based Local Landmark Function) L ab (S) = arg min {δ(r, a) + δ(r, b)} r {LCA Tl (a,b) l S} T l : The shortest path tree rooted at l S LCA Tl (a, b) : The Least common ancestor of a and b in T l l 1 l 2 l 1 c d e c d a e f g b a f g h h l 2 b l 3 l 3 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

17 SPT Based Local Landmark Function Definition (SPT Based Local Landmark Function) L ab (S) = arg min {δ(r, a) + δ(r, b)} r {LCA Tl (a,b) l S} T l : The shortest path tree rooted at l S LCA Tl (a, b) : The Least common ancestor of a and b in T l l 1 c=lca T (a, b) e d δ L (a, b) = δ(c, a) + δ(c, b) a f g = δ(l 1, a) + δ(l 1, b) 2δ(l 1, c) h l 2 b l 3 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

18 SPT Based Local Landmark Function Accuracy a, b V, Complexity LCA Query Time: O(1) Online Query Time: O( S ) δ(a, b) δ L (a, b) δ(a, b) Offline Embedding Space: O( S V ) Offline Embedding TimeO( S V log( V )) SAME complexities as the global landmark embedding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

21 Index Reduction with Graph Compression Lossless graph compression by removing two special types of nodes: Tree node Map to the entry node Remove the tree node Chain node Map to two end nodes Remove the chain node c b a e g d h f i j k n o l m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

23 Index Reduction with Graph Compression For a V, case a: Tree node: map(a) contains a entry node Chain node: map(a) contains two end nodes Otherwise: map(a) contains only itself Query time: O( S ) δ L (a, b) = min {δ(a, r a) + δ L (r a, r b ) + δ(b, r b )} r a map(a),r b map(b) Index size Reduce size from O( S V ) to O( V + ( S 1) V ) V : the number of nodes in the compressed graph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23

26 Improving the Accuracy by Local Search Cost-effective Local Search Procedure Connect two query nodes to local landmarks through the shortest paths Expand each node to include its c-hop neighbors a lca 1 lca 3 lca 2 The expanded nodes may form shortcuts which provide tighter distance estimation lca 4 b Miao Qiao, et al (CUHK) Approximate Shortest Distance Computing March 29, / 23
